𝐂𝐇𝐄𝐂𝐊𝐏𝐎𝐈𝐍𝐓-𝐄𝐕𝐀𝐒𝐈𝐎𝐍 𝐀𝐓𝐓𝐄𝐌𝐏𝐓 𝐋𝐄𝐀𝐃𝐒 𝐓𝐎 𝐏𝟏.𝟐𝐌 𝐒𝐌𝐔𝐆𝐆𝐋𝐄𝐃 𝐂𝐈𝐆𝐀𝐑𝐄𝐓𝐓𝐄 𝐁𝐔𝐒𝐓 𝐈𝐍 𝐋𝐀𝐍𝐀𝐎 𝐃𝐄𝐋 𝐍𝐎𝐑𝐓𝐄

CAMP ALAGAR, Cagayan de Oro City – A failed attempt to evade a police checkpoint resulted in the confiscation of PhP1.2 million worth of smuggled cigarettes and the arrest of two suspects in Nunungan, Lanao del Norte at around 8:00 PM on August 20, 2025.

The arrested individuals were identified as Saide, 29 years old, married, driver, and Baste, 29 years old, single, assistant driver, both residents of Tubod, Lanao del Norte.

Reports revealed that personnel of the Nunungan Municipal Police Station (MPS) were conducting mobile patrol when they received a tip from concerned citizens about a suspicious vehicle temporarily parked at Purok 1, Brgy. Masibay, Nunungan. The red Toyota Innova was reportedly parked about 40 meters away from an ongoing checkpoint to avoid inspection.

Responding joint operatives of Nunungan MPS, 2nd PMFC, and the Maritime Monitoring Team of LDN MARSTA immediately proceeded to the location. Through the vehicle’s open window, they observed several boxes of cigarettes. When asked, the suspects failed to present any legal documents for the items.

Accordingly, the smuggled cigarettes allegedly originated from Sultan Naga Dimaporo, Lanao del Norte, and were bound for Tubod, Lanao del Norte.

Confiscated items included 11 master cases of New Far (Red), 10 master cases of New Far (Green), 3 master cases of New Berlin (Red), 3 master cases of Fort, and 3 master cases of Cannon, with a total estimated market value of PhP1,200,000.00.

The suspects and the confiscated items are now under the custody of Nunungan MPS and will be turnover to the Bureau of Customs-Iligan City for proper disposition.

PBGEN ROLINDO M SUGUILON, Regional Director, PRO10, commended the swift action of the operating units and the vigilance of the community that led to the successful interception.
